ONS engages political parties on peace

By Prince J Musa in Kenema

The Office of National Security (ONS) has ended a post-election peace and social cohesion dialogue with political parties, security sector, Political Parties Regulation Commission (PPRC) and other players in the Election Management Bodies (EMBs).

The engagement took place at the Kenema City Hall, Maada Bio Street in Kenema on the 26th July, 2023.

Boycotts are no longer fashionable – Speaker of Sierra Leone Parliament tells opposition

By Alpha Abu

The Speaker of Sierra Leone’s Parliament, Dr. Abass Chernor Bundu says walk-outs and boycotts have lost their value and relevance in this 21st Century.

Dr. Bundu’s statement in Parliament on Monday 24th July 2023 was directed at the main opposition All People’s Congress (APC) whose Members of Parliament have boycotted sittings of the Sixth Parliament, since the announcement of the June General Elections, because of what the party alleged were irregularities in the polls.

Bo pistol suspect and eight others in court

By Saio Marrah

A 47-Year-old Farmer, Alpha Sheriff of No.1 Sheriff Drive, Kamabai town in Bombali District, has appeared before a magistrate court in Freetown for unlawful possession of a grey and black Taurus Armas Revolver Pistol in Kebbie town Bo District.

The accused is also charged with unlawful concealment of the same gun on 7th June this year.

Sheriff, first accused, was among nine men that appeared before Magistrate Mark Ngegba at the Pademba Road Court No.1 in Freetown on Tuesday 25 July 2023, facing various charges.
